Colony of the Massachusetts Bay. August 18, 1775. Seventeen Shillings. No.836. Payable on August 18,...Colony of the Massachusetts Bay. August 18, 1775. Seventeen Shillings. No.836. Payable on August 18, 1778. Signed by Plympton and Sayer? [very faint in blue]. Revere Sword in Hand Note. Printed on thick, coarse stock. 76mm by 100mm. Standard face and back designs. This denomination represented in the epic Ford X Sale offering in May, 2006, but with a variety nuance (see Ford Part X, lot 4654). A strong example and genuine. The back printing is exceptionally sharp and from an early plate state for the issue. Very Fine. The note is creased, but not broken. Quite broad with great margins. The soiling is light and there is some moderate dirt on the back. A penned line across the top back edge, a quarter inch from the top. One of the finest Swords in this second group of Revere printed notes from the Boyd collection.

Ex F.C.C. Boyd Estate.
